Navigating Privacy: A Deep Dive into Washington's Do-Not-Call List

The Washington State Do-Not-Call List is a fundamental component of the state's efforts to protect consumers from unwanted telemarketing calls. Governed by the Washington Telemarketing Act (WTA), this list empowers residents to proactively opt-out of receiving calls from telemarketers, creating a shield against intrusive and unsolicited communication.
